Off-site records storage costs continue to rise, and many firms are discovering they have less visibility, flexibility, and long-term protection in their contracts than they expected.
In this 45-minute Coffee Break, Rob Mattern, President of Mattern, and John Riggleman, Firm Administrator of Caplin & Drysdale, discuss how the firm approached a major off-site storage contract renewal after facing a 35.5% increase in costs and ultimately developed a strategy focused on long-term savings and operational control.
This practical conversation explores the realities of off-site records management today, including contract negotiations, retention strategy, destruction practices, and the hidden costs that often go unmanaged for years.
